إعدادات البوت
كل بوت في AISCouncil معرف بكائن إعدادات يتحكم في مزوده ونموذجه وسلوكه ومظهره. هذه الصفحة توثق مخطط الإعدادات الكامل وتشرح كل حقل.
لوحة الإعدادات
تنزلق لوحة الإعدادات من الجانب الأيمن للشاشة. مرئية افتراضيًا على سطح المكتب وقابلة للوصول عبر أيقونة الإعدادات على الهاتف المحمول. تحتوي اللوحة على:
- محددات المزود والنموذج في الأعلى
- منطقة نص موجه النظام
- معاملات التوليد (درجة الحرارة، الحد الأقصى للرموز، إلخ)
- إعدادات متقدمة (قسم قابل للتوسيع)
- إعدادات الشخصية (أيقونة، وصف، لون)
- حقل مفتاح API لكل بوت
يتم حفظ التغييرات تلقائيًا أثناء التحرير.
الحقول الأساسية
المزود
مزود LLM الذي يستضيف النموذج. اختر من القائمة المنسدلة:
| المزود | مصدر مفتاح API | ملاحظات |
|---|---|---|
| Anthropic | console.anthropic.com | نماذج Claude -- استدلال متقدم |
| OpenAI | platform.openai.com | GPT-4o، o3، DALL-E |
| xAI | console.x.ai | نماذج Grok |
| Google Gemini | aistudio.google.com | مستوى Flash مجاني متاح |
| OpenRouter | openrouter.ai | أكثر من 300 نموذج، مستوى مجاني |
| Groq | console.groq.com | استدلال LPU فائق السرعة |
| DeepSeek | platform.deepseek.com | نماذج الاستدلال R1 و V3 |
| Mistral | console.mistral.ai | Large، Small، Codestral |
| Ollama | غير متاح (محلي) | يعمل محليًا، لا حاجة لمفتاح API |
| مخصص | معرف من المستخدم | أي نقطة نهاية متوافقة مع OpenAI |
تغيير المزود يحدث القائمة المنسدلة للنموذج لعرض النماذج المتاحة لذلك المزود.
النموذج
النموذج المحدد من المزود المختار. يتم ملء القائمة المنسدلة من سجل النماذج المجتمعي وتعرض:
- اسم النموذج ومعرفه
- مستوى التسعير (مجاني أو مدفوع)
- حجم نافذة السياق
- القدرات (رؤية، استدلال، أدوات)
عند اختيار نموذج، تظهر بطاقة معلومات أسفل القائمة المنسدلة تعرض الأسعار (إدخال/مخرج لكل مليون رمز) وحجم نافذة السياق والحد الأقصى لرموز المخرجات وعلامات القدرات. هذا يساعدك على اختيار النموذج المناسب لمهمتك.
موجه النظام
تعليمات تُرسل للنموذج في بداية كل محادثة. تحدد سلوك البوت وشخصيته وقيوده. راجع موجهات النظام للإرشادات والقوالب التفصيلية.
يشتمل حقل موجه النظام على قائمة منسدلة للقوالب مع 5 مسبقات مدمجة. اختر قالبًا وخصصه حسب احتياجاتك.
درجة الحرارة
تتحكم في العشوائية/الإبداع في الردود.
| القيمة | السلوك |
|---|---|
| 0 | حتمي -- يختار دائمًا الرمز الأكثر احتمالًا |
| 0.3 | محافظ -- ردود مركزة ومتسقة |
| 0.7 | متوازن (افتراضي) -- مزيج جيد من الإبداع والتماسك |
| 1.0 | مبدع -- ردود أكثر تنوعًا |
| 1.5-2.0 | مبدع جدًا -- غير متوقع، تجريبي |
الحد الأقصى للرموز
الحد الأقصى لعدد الرموز التي يمكن للنموذج توليدها في رد واحد. النطاق: 128 إلى 16,384 (أو أعلى للنماذج التي تدعمه). الافتراضي: 4,096.
ضبط الحد الأقصى للرموز منخفض جدًا قد يسبب قطع الرد في منتصف الجملة. ضبطه عاليًا جدًا قد يزيد التكاليف للنماذج المدفوعة. 4,096 هو افتراضي جيد لمعظم حالات الاستخدام.
الحقول المتقدمة
وسّع قسم متقدم في لوحة الإعدادات للوصول إلى هذه المعاملات.
جهد الاستدلال / التفكير
للنماذج التي تدعم التفكير الممتد (Claude، سلسلة GPT o، DeepSeek R1، نماذج Gemini التفكيرية)، هذا يتحكم في كمية الحساب التي يقضيها النموذج في الاستدلال قبل الرد.
| القيمة | الوصف |
|---|---|
| مغلق | لا تفكير ممتد (رد قياسي) |
| منخفض | استدلال最小ي، أسرع الردود |
| متوسط | عمق استدلال معتدل |
| عالي | استدلال عميق، أكثر شمولية |
| الأعلى | أقصى جهد استدلال |
| مخصص | اضبط عدد رموز الميزانية المخصص |
ليست كل النماذج تدعم وضع الاستدلال/التفكير. يظهر الحقل فقط عندما يدعمه النموذج أو المزود المحدد. النماذج المعروفة بدعم الاستدلال تشمل Anthropic Claude (التفكير الممتد)، سلسلة OpenAI o1/o3، DeepSeek R1، xAI Grok، ونماذج Google Gemini التفكيرية.
Top P (أخذ عينات النواة)
يتحكم في عتبة الاحتمال التراكمي لاختيار الرموز. الافتراضي: 1.0 (بدون تصفية).
1.0-- اعتبر جميع الرموز (افتراضي)0.9-- اعتبر الرموز التي تشكل أعلى 90% من كتلة الاحتمال0.1-- مقيد جدًا، تقريبًا حتمي
يُوصى عمومًا بضبط إما درجة الحرارة أو Top P، وليس كلاهما في نفس الوقت. تغيير كلاهما قد ينتج نتائج غير متوقعة.
عقوبة التكرار
تقلل من احتمالية تكرار النموذج لرموز ظهرت بالفعل. النطاق: 0 إلى 2. الافتراضي: 0.
0-- لا عقوبة (افتراضي)0.5-- تخفيف تكرار معتدل1.0-2.0-- تخفيف تكرار قوي
عقوبة الوجود
تشجع النموذج على التحدث عن مواضيع جديدة بمعاقبة الرموز التي ظهرت على الإطلاق. النطاق: 0 إلى 2. الافتراضي: 0.
0-- لا عقوبة (افتراضي)0.5-- تشجيع تنوع المواضيع معتدل1.0-2.0-- دفع قوي نحو مواضيع جديدة
البذرة
قيمة عددية لمخرجات قابلة للتكرار. عند استخدام نفس البذرة والموجه والمعاملات، يحاول النموذج إرجاع نفس الرد. ليست كل المزودين يدعمون هذه الميزة.
متواليات التوقف
قائمة مفصولة بفواصل من رموز التوقف المخصصة. عندما يولد النموذج أي من هذه المتواليات، يتوقف عن إنتاج مخرجات إضافية. مفيد للمخرجات المنظمة أو سيناريوهات لعب الأدوار.
مثال: END,---,</answer> يجعل النموذج يتوقف عندما يولد END أو --- أو </answer>.
تنسيق الرد
يتحكم في تنسيق المخرجات:
| القيمة | الوصف |
|---|---|
text | مخرجات نصية قياسية (افتراضي) |
json | يفرض مخرجات JSON (يجب أن يدعم النموذج المخرجات المنظمة) |
وضع JSON يتطلب أن يوجه موجه النظام النموذج لإنتاج JSON. مجرد ضبط تنسيق الرد على JSON دون ذكره في الموجه قد يؤدي إلى أخطاء أو مخرجات تالفة.
استدعاء الأدوات
كوّن استدعاء الدوال/الأدوات للنماذج التي تدعمه. هذه ميزة متقدمة لبناء بوتات يمكنها استدعاء أدوات خارجية أو إجراءات منظمة.
مفتاح API لكل بوت
كل بوت يمكنه استخدام مفتاح API مختلف عن المفتاح العام:
- ابحث عن حقل مفتاح API في لوحة الإعدادات (أسفل محدد المزود)
- أدخل مفتاحًا خاصًا بهذا البوت
- هذا المفتاح يتجاوز المفتاح العام لهذا البوت فقط
يتم تخزين مفاتيح كل بوت محليًا ولا تُضمّن أبدًا في عناوين URL للبوتات المشتركة.
مفاتيح الإعدادات المختصرة
داخليًا، تستخدم إعدادات البوت مفاتيح مختصرة لضغط URL بكفاءة. هذا مفيد إذا كنت تبني تكاملات أو تنحي عناوين URL المشتركة:
| المفتاح المختصر | الاسم الكامل | النوع | الافتراضي |
|---|---|---|---|
n | الاسم | نص | "New Bot" |
p | المزود | نص | "anthropic" |
m | النموذج | نص | -- |
s | موجه النظام | نص | "" |
t | درجة الحرارة | رقم | 0.7 |
x | الحد الأقصى للرموز | رقم | 4096 |
tp | Top P | رقم | 1.0 |
fp | عقوبة التكرار | رقم | 0 |
pp | عقوبة الوجود | رقم | 0 |
se | البذرة | رقم | -- |
re | جهد الاستدلال | نص | -- |
st | متواليات التوقف | نص | -- |
rf | تنسيق الرد | نص | "text" |
tc | اختيار الأداة | نص | -- |
tl | قائمة الأدوات | مصفوفة | -- |
pi | أيقونة الشخصية | نص | -- |
pd | وصف الشخصية | نص | -- |
pc | لون الشخصية | نص | -- |
إعدادات المجلس (مفتاح c)
عندما يكون البوت مجلسًا (عضوان أو أكثر)، يحتوي مفتاح c على:
| المفتاح المختصر | الاسم الكامل | النوع | الافتراضي |
|---|---|---|---|
cs | نمط المجلس | نص | "council" |
ms | الأعضاء | مصفوفة | -- |
ch | الرئيس | رقم | 0 |
vm | وضع التصويت | نص | "weighted" |
sr | تخطي المراجعة | منطقي | false |
mx | الحد الأقصى للرموز (لكل عضو) | رقم | 1024 |
dr | جولات المداولة | رقم | 2 |
إعدادات المحادثة
هذه الإعدادات لكل بوت تتحكم في تجربة المحادثة:
| الإعداد | المفتاح المختصر | الوصف | الافتراضي |
|---|---|---|---|
| حد السياق | cl | الحد الأقصى للرسائل المرسلة إلى API (0 = غير محدود) | غير محدود |
| التدفق | sm | تدفق الرموز في الوقت الفعلي | مفعّل |
| العنوان التلقائي | at | توليد عناوين المحادثات تلقائيًا | معطّل |
| Markdown | mr | عرض markdown في الردود | مفعّل |
| عرض عدد الرموز | stc | عرض استخدام الرموز لكل رسالة | معطّل |
تحرير الإعدادات الخام
توفر لوحة الإعدادات محررًا مرئيًا لجميع الحقول. لا تحتاج لتحرير JSON الخام في الاستخدام العادي. ومع ذلك، التنسيق الداخلي موثق هنا للمطورين الذين يبنون تكاملات أو مزودين مخصصين أو أدوات تولد إعدادات البوت برمجيًا.
مثال على الإعدادات الخام:
{
"n": "مساعد الكود",
"p": "anthropic",
"m": "claude-sonnet-4-20250514",
"s": "أنت مهندس برمجيات خبير. قدم كودًا واضحًا وموثقًا جيدًا مع شروحات.",
"t": 0.3,
"x": 8192,
"pi": "💻",
"pd": "مساعد هندسة البرمجيات",
"pc": "#4a90d9"
}